## Deploying the occupancy feed

The Garrowpark occupancy feed is a single Go binary that polls the gate sensors every few seconds and publishes counts to the city dashboard. Deploys are boring on purpose: build, push, restart — no migrations, no state beyond a tiny cache. If the feed flatlines, it's almost always a sensor auth token, not the service. Before starting the binary on a fresh box, drop in the config values listed here.

settings of kajep-kawip:
[zorys]
host = zorys.urlaqgrid.corp
user = zorys_svc
database = zorys_prod

# Build Provenance: Monthly Table Partitioning — Ledgervale

The Ledgervale warehouse partitions event tables by calendar month. Each partition is created by the nightly provisioner two weeks ahead of the month boundary, and the migration that created it is recorded alongside the build that shipped it. On call: if a partition is missing, do not create it by hand; rerun the provisioner and verify provenance against the token recorded below.

pipeline stamp: htk6_7941f2

Spindlewheel computes nightly truck routes to rebalance bikes across the Dockmere network. Inputs are station fill levels pulled from the telemetry service; outputs are route manifests pushed to driver tablets. For the security review: the service runs with a read-only telemetry credential, the manifest push uses mutual TLS, and route data contains no rider information. Open items are credential rotation cadence and audit logging for manual overrides. Questions during the transition should go to the owner named below.

account owner for kafop-haweg: Pelax Gilael Istir

## Artifact signing — ParcelPing webhook

Quick version: every webhook build gets signed before it hits the relay, so downstream folks can verify payload handlers weren't tampered with. The verify step runs in CI automatically; you only care about the key material. For audit purposes, the current signing key is listed here.

signing key of bagap-yawep = bky13_TbfT6ZMUoGJo2